Application to get address details from zip code Using Python

Prerequisite: Tkinter
In this article, we are going to write scripts to get address details from a given Zip code or Pincode using tkinter and geopy module in python, Tkinter is the most commonly used GUI module in python to illustrate graphical objects and geopy is a python module to locate the coordinates of addresses, cities, countries, landmarks, and zip code.
Installation:
The tkinter module is an in-built module in Python, however, we need to install geopy module:
pip install geopy
Approach:
- Import geopy module.
- Use Nominatim API to access the corresponding to a set of coordinates, nominatim uses OpenStreetMap data to find locations on Earth by name and address (geocoding).
- Use geocode() to get the location of given Zipcode and displaying it.
Below is the implementation of the above approach:
Python3
from geopy.geocoders import Nominatim
geolocator = Nominatim(user_agent = "geoapiExercises" )
zipcode = "800011"
location = geolocator.geocode(zipcode)
print ( "Zipcode:" ,zipcode)
print ( "Details of the Zipcode:" )
print (location)
|
Output:
Zipcode: 800011
Details of the Zipcode:
Danapur, Dinapur-Cum-Khagaul, Patna, Bihar, 800011, India
Below is a GUI implementation of the above program using tkinter module:
Python3
from geopy.geocoders import Nominatim
from tkinter import *
def zip_code():
try :
geolocator = Nominatim(user_agent = "geoapiExercises" )
zipcode = str (e.get())
location = geolocator.geocode(zipcode)
res. set (location.address)
except :
location = "Oops! something went wrong"
res. set (location)
master = Tk()
master.configure(bg = 'light grey' )
res = StringVar();
Label(master, text = "Zipcode: " , bg = "light grey" ).grid(row = 0 , sticky = W)
Label(master, text = "Details of the pincode:" , bg = "light grey" ).grid(row = 3 , sticky = W)
Label(master, text = " ", textvariable=res,bg = " light grey").grid(row = 3 ,column = 1 , sticky = W)
e = Entry(master)
e.grid(row = 0 , column = 1 )
b = Button(master, text = "Show" , command = zip_code )
b.grid(row = 0 , column = 2 ,columnspan = 2 , rowspan = 2 ,padx = 5 , pady = 5 )
mainloop()
